Hilux Dakar & Fortuner Limited Editions

The Toyota Hilux and Fortuner are together the two most popular pickup and SUV models in South Africa. Since the Hilux’s introduction to South Africa in 1969, it has failed on three occasions only, to bag the best-selling LCV (Light Commercial Vehicle) title. In fact Toyota’s remarkable success and market leadership in South Africa, can be largely attributed to the trusty, tough-as-nails Hilux. And if your travels in South Africa happen to take you to the Free State, you will most likely be further convinced that the Hilux belongs right there next to Biltong, Braaivleis and Mrs Balls Chutney  as true South African icons.

And recently another proud “South African” story has been capturing the world’s attention. A South African built Hilux, driven by our own Giniel de Villiers has been giving the premier rally teams a lekker run for their money in the Dakar Rally, fondly referred to as the World’s Toughest Race. Giniel powered his Hilux to 3rd overall in 2012, and improved to a stunning 2nd in 2013. Hilux Dakar Edition 2013

List of extra features

Exterior
* Stainless steel nudge bar with Dakar logo
* Stainless steel rear styling bar with Dakar logo
* Stainless steel side steps with Dakar logo
* Rear step bumper with Towbar
* Black Tonneau cover
* Smoky gray wheels
* Body coloured mirrors
* Body coloured door handles
* Dakar badge on rear of vehicle

Interior
* Black leather seats with red stitching
* Black leather door inserts with red stitching
* Black carpet set with red Dakar embroidery and red border
* Reverse camera (Xtra cab and Double cab only)

Fortuner LTD Edition

The Fortuner also gets some special treatment with this Limited Edition.

An impressive list of standard equipment is one of the highlights of the Fortuner – full leather upholstery, stability control (VSC), touch screen audio with reverse monitor, Bluetooth, automatic climate control, auto headlights, and iPod connectivity are just some of the items on the menu.

The new LTD Edition series builds on the standard model offering by adding several lifestyle enhancements:

• Stainless steel nudge bar with unique branded, cut-out “LTD Edition” badging
• Stainless steel side steps with unique branded, cut-out “LTD Edition” badging
• Tow bar with matt black finish
• Rear sill protector
• Smokey grey 17” alloys
• Chrome side mirrors
• “LTD Edition” rear badging
• Overlay carpet set with “LTD Edition” embroidery
